2. Steps to find factors of 5000 using Prime Factorization

A prime number is a number that has exactly two factors, 1 and the number itself. Prime factorization of a number means breaking down of the number into the form of products of its prime factors.

There are two different methods that can be used for the prime factorization.

Method 1: Division Method

To find the primefactors of 5000 using the division method, follow these steps:

  • Step 1. Start dividing 5000 by the smallest prime number, i.e., 2, 3, 5, and so on. Find the smallest prime factor of the number.
  • Step 2. After finding the smallest prime factor of the number 5000, which is 2. Divide 5000 by 2 to obtain the quotient (2500).
    5000 ÷ 2 = 2500
  • Step 3. Repeat step 1 with the obtained quotient (2500).
    2500 ÷ 2 = 1250
    1250 ÷ 2 = 625
    625 ÷ 5 = 125
    125 ÷ 5 = 25
    25 ÷ 5 = 5
    5 ÷ 5 = 1

So, the prime factorization of 5000 is, 5000 = 2 x 2 x 2 x 5 x 5 x 5 x 5.

3. Find factors of 5000 in Pairs

Pair factors of a number are any two numbers which, which on multiplying together, give that number as a result. The pair factors of 5000 would be the two numbers which, when multiplied, give 5000 as the result.

The following table represents the calculation of factors of 5000 in pairs:

Factor Pair Pair Factorization
1 and 5000 1 x 5000 = 5000
2 and 2500 2 x 2500 = 5000
4 and 1250 4 x 1250 = 5000
5 and 1000 5 x 1000 = 5000
8 and 625 8 x 625 = 5000
10 and 500 10 x 500 = 5000
20 and 250 20 x 250 = 5000
25 and 200 25 x 200 = 5000
40 and 125 40 x 125 = 5000
50 and 100 50 x 100 = 5000

Since the product of two negative numbers gives a positive number, the product of the negative values of both the numbers in a pair factor will also give 5000. They are called negative pair factors.

Hence, the negative pairs of 5000 would be ( -1 , -5000 ) , ( -2 , -2500 ) , ( -4 , -1250 ) , ( -5 , -1000 ) , ( -8 , -625 ) , ( -10 , -500 ) , ( -20 , -250 ) , ( -25 , -200 ) , ( -40 , -125 ) and ( -50 , -100 ) .

What are factors?

In mathematics, a factor is that number which divides into another number exactly, without leaving a remainder. A factor of a number can be positive or negative.

Properties of factors

  • Each number is a factor of itself. Eg. 5000 is a factor of itself.
  • 1 is a factor of every number. Eg. 1 is a factor of 5000.
  • Every number is a factor of zero (0), since 5000 x 0 = 0.
  • Every number other than 1 has at least two factors, namely the number itself and 1.
